Hollis, Dave. Get out of Your Own Way.
"I suffered from this disease of always having to be right in any conversation and all arguments for most of my life."--Dave Hollis.
Its honesty like that statement that really drew me in and made me want to read this book. A natural skeptic, Hollis describe a long evolution in his thinking. At first, he was opposed to the self-help movement an is now the CEO of the Hollis company, a company that asserts it gives people the tools to make positive, lasting change.

Library Podcasts
The Librarian Is In, NYPL podcast. Hosts, Frank and Rhonda, Hosts discuss current situation (COVID-19) and what they've been reading in the April 23, 2020 episode. Rhonda discusses Freedom Libraries and Frank discusses The Man Who Loved Children.
Your Shelf or Mine, Longview Public Library podcast (Longview, WA). Discusses the current situation (COVID-19) and discusses a library program the adult librarian is giving along with CORE(a small business webinar). They sound like they are working mostly from home and taking turns to go into the library. The Longview Public Library (WA) offers painting classes online at Youtube. The hosts discuss books they have read.

"If I should have a daughter" by Sarah Kay
This is an amazing poem about motherhood, starting over, finding strength in the face of adversity; its also filled with Sarah Kay's trademark humor.
